“It Ain’t Easy” is the second single from Delta Spirit’s new album “What Is There” (out Sept. 11), their first full-length since 2014.
Delta Spirit returns in September with their first album in six years, “What Is There.” The video for the widescreen first single “How Bout It” features 30 cinematographers from across the nation collaborating with director Michael Parks Randa for poignant portraits of Americans in isolation.
